I'm having a rather odd result and I was hoping someone would explain why this might be occurring.
I have short video taken from a moving car (video: 00:00:07.508, 29.970 fps interlaced, 1920x1080x12, AVC). I have matched my project settings to this.
I am trying to get a stop action video from this. So I adjust the undersampling rate to .1 and the playback in Vegas Pro (version 10) is fine.
When I render to an interlaced MXF format (60i) the video is ghosting and blurry but when I render to a progressive (24p) the video is sharp.
Smart, Force or Disabled Resampling is having no impact here (at least that I can see)
Why is this happenning and if I wanted my output to be interlaced, how could I avoid this ghosting?
